Msp430afe2xx 16bit microcontrollers msp430afe2x3 mcus architecture and integrated low power modes are designed to extend the length of battery life in portable. Rob14451 tb6612fng motor controllerdriver power management evaluation board from sparkfun electronics. Sparkfun robotics 101 9 dc motor control systems sparkfun electronics. Brushless dc gimbal ptz motor ht100 this is a brushless motor that require a controller as well. Easydriver stepper motor driver, rob12779 antratek. We recommend the sparkfun redboard or any other arduino form factor boards such as the arduino uno or the arduino leonardo one of the main features of the driver shield is to make working with motors easier for those just learning. How to power and control brushless dc motors digikey. Over 75 developers have made contributions towards building a robust, extensible and composable ecosystem. Motor driver 15a irf7862pbf rob09107 sparkfun electronics. This is our new hobby motor now with a 6mm, 10 tooth, gear to make your basic projects a little simpler to manage. Sparkfun qwiic motor driver 15451 the sparkfun qwiic motor driver takes all the great features of the serial controlled motor driver scmd and miniaturizes them, adding qwiic ports for plug and play functionality. Two input signals in1 and in2 can be used to control the motor in one of four function modes.
This tiny breakout board for tis drv8838 motor driver can deliver a continuous 1. The sparkfun haptic motor driver breakout board features six pins to provide power to the sensor and i2c bus. Sparkfun motor driver dual tb6612fng with headers the tb6612fng motor driver can control up to two dc motors at a constant current of 1. If youre using an arduino or other microcontroller such as the sparkfun servo trigger to control your motor. Rob14451 sparkfun electronics development boards, kits. See description for more details about the product. This is the tinyesc v2 from fingertech robotics, an ultra small bidirectional brushed motor controller for driving equally small dc motors. Where things become complicated is orchestrating the sequence of energizing coils.
Brushless dc motor control adafruit learning system. The voltage is 24 80 vdc, normally linear power supply applied see appendix, ripple voltage higher than 50v may damage driver. Brushless dc bldc motor drivers from ti simplify industrial, automotive and functional safety applications. Brushless motor t 3000kv rob09696 sparkfun electronics. The sparkfun wireless motor driver shield is designed to make connecting motors, sensors and other components to your arduinobased project as fast and easy as possible. Brushless dc motor drive circuit nxp semiconductors.
I have mapped the 0255 to a 0100 range so i can run in humanreadable percentages. Im have a brushless motor and esc, which im trying to control using an arduino uno for my first quadrotor project. Motors provide a way for our devices to interact with us and the environment. Serial controlled motor driver scmd rob911 repository contents examples example sketches for the library. Crank up your robotics with powerful adafruit drv8871 motor driver breakout board. Whatsmore, the motor comes with directional control, pwm speed control and speed feedback output, which make this motor to be controlled easily. Unfollow brushless dc motor driver to stop getting updates on your ebay feed. This board breaks out texas instruments drv2605l haptic motor driver, which adds meaningful feedback from your devices using the breakout.
This is an arduino shield that integrates an hbridge driver. Learn how easy it is to use the tb6612fng motor driver by sparkfun. Turnigys electronic speed controller is a fine choice when high burst currents are needed for powering brushless motors. Sparkfun quadstepper motor driver rob10507 the quadstepper motor driver board allows you to control up to 4 bipolar stepper motors simultaneously using logic level io pins. The brushless dc motor driver circuit described here uses a drv10866 driver ic to drive a small bldc fan, without using any position sensors. If you will be driving the motor hard, a 1020% safety factor in the esc rating is a good idea. Some brushless gimbal controller will feature a rc input to mo. When low, the driver chip is enabled and the motor is energized. In highspeed travel, this can lead to stalling where the rotor cant keep up with the sequence. Before continuing with this guide, you may want to check out any topics from. The sparkfun serial controlled motor driver scmd is a dc motor driver thats been designed to drive small dc motors with ease. Released by bocoup in 2012, johnnyfive is maintained by a community of passionate software developers and hardware engineers. The heart of the wireless motor driver shield is the toshiba tb6612fng hbridge motor driver. Brushless dc motor driver full project with circuit available.
Sparkfun serial controlled motor driver arduino library. The magnets are on the conventional motor shaft and the. A global provider of products, services, and solutions, arrow aggregates electronic components and enterprise computing solutions for customers and suppliers in industrial and commercial markets. Servo generic continuous rotation micro size here, for all your mechatronic needs, is a simple, high quality. Created a laser scanner using this to control my stepper motor. The ezrun brushless inrunner motors give a lot of power for a little price. So far i have 4 3phase brushless drive motors rated for 36v and 7a with 20a peak, i also have.
The easydriver requires a 6v to 30v supply to power the motor and can power any voltage of stepper motor. It can be conncected to arduino directly without external motor driver. I am using pwm to control the pump quite successfully. Brushed dc motor control rc servo control this guide was first published on may 21. To control the motor driver i posted a link to, you use 4 digital pins to set the direction each motor. Brushless motor controller shield for arduino hackaday. In particular, the simple resistorset current limiting and automagic pwm support make it super easy to use. Whatsmore, the motor comes with directional control, pwm speed control and speed feedback output, which make this motor. The easydriver is a simple to use stepper motor driver, compatible with anything that can output a digital 0 to 5v pulse or 0 to 3. In this project i implemented a simple software pwm code because i had needed an active pwm signal on pin 2, 4 or 6 only one is active at a time, for that i used timer2 module and i configured it with a prescaler of 18 which means the pwm signal frequency is about 7. Roboteq hbl2360 brushless dc motor controller, dual channel, 2 x 75. Brushed dc motor control rc servo control this guide was first published on may 21, 2014. These inputs are all tied high with 20k ohm resistors.
Motors and drivers all products sparkfun electronics. Arrow electronics guides innovation forward for over 200,000 of the worlds leading manufacturers of technology used in homes, business and daily life. Picking a motor driver for a motor that is not powerful enough isnt helpful. Sparkfun electronics the tb6612fng motor driver can control up to two dc motors at a constant current of 1. Aside from the wireless motor driver shield, you will also need to stack the shield to a microcontroller. Also, keep in mind there are different motor types stepper, dc, brushless, so make. The pololu 15 amp highpower motor driver is a discrete mosfet hbridge designed to drive one dc brushed motor. Sparkfun serial motor driver read 8806 times previous topic next topic.
Sparkfun wireless motor driver shield dev14285 arduino shield with builtin motor driver and xbee slot. Dual monster moto shield vnh2sp30 dc motor driver 2x14a peak 30a sanjay upadhyay verified owner september 17, 2018 this is an excellent motor driver for building mega motor robots. A bldc fans speed can be varied smoothly, without the usual steps associated with a normal ac fan. I may need to slow down the turns since it is in 18 of a step by default which is great. Driver chips and components for bldc gimbal control. Pololu drv8838 single brushed dc motor driver carrier. Two input signals in1 and in2 can be used to control the motor. The output current of lps shall be 60% more than that of driver. Our brushless dc motor driver bldc8015a is an easytouse motor driver. Pololu dual g2 highpower motor driver 24v14 shield for arduino product code.
They can provide haptic feedback for notification, add movement to your robot, help 3d print a model, or cnc mill a material. A brushless motor loses the brushes and the commutator. It can be commanded by uart, i2c, or spi communication, and it can drive a constant 1. Turnigy brushless 35a esc rob09698 sparkfun electronics. The tb6612fng motor driver can control up to two dc motors at a constant current of 1. Dc gearmotors or brushless dc motors are more likely candidates, but they arent directly compatible with servo control signals.
Released by bocoup in 2012, johnnyfive is maintained by a community of passionate software developers and hardware. Im sort of new to robotics and its my first time not using a premade motor driver. Our 3phase brushless dc motor drivers offer the flexibility of integrated motor commutation logic or easily pair with external microcontrollers for sensored and sensorless bldc motor control. Can someone tell me what specs i should look at, or point me to a guide, or even better, recommend a mosfet with the reasoning behind it. Brushless motor 9t 4300kv rob09697 sparkfun electronics.
Choosing mosfets to control a brushless dc bldc motor. Sparkfun qwiic motor driver the sparkfun qwiic motor driver takes all the great features of the serial controlled motor driver scmd and miniaturizes them, adding qwiic ports for plug and play functionality. Sparkfun motor driver dual tb6612fng with headers in stock rob14450 the tb6612fng motor driver can control up to two dc motors at a constant current of 1. I tried a smaller pump that used a similar brushless motor also from hargravesparker and it works just fine. Sparkfun fullbridge motor driver breakout l298n out of stock bob09540.
Sparkfun motor driver dual tb6612fng with headers rob845 the tb6612fng motor driver can control up to two dc motors at a constant current of 1. However, brushless motors have begun to dominate the. Some basic motors types include dc brush, servos, brushless, stepper, linear motors. Schematic the motor well control is connected to the motor a output pins, so we need to wire the enablea, input1 and input2 pins of the motor driver to the esp32. Transient voltage suppression sparkfun electronics. This motor driver has a lot of great specs that make it useful for a wide variety of mechatronics. When high, the driver chip is still enabled, but all of the final motor drive circuits are disabled and so no current will flow to the motor.
Controlling a brushless motor through esc using arduino. Dec 31, 2017 sensored brushless dc motor control with arduino code. The mechanics of a linear motor is nearly identical to a brushless motor. Oct 19, 2016 how to home stepper motors using limit switches tutorial using arduino and easy driver duration. Sparkfun motor driver dual tb6612fng 1a arduino shoppen. The sparkfun qwiic motor driver takes all the great features of the serial controlled motor driver scmd and miniturizes them, adding qwiic ports for plug and play. Usage adafruit drv8871 brushed dc motor driver breakout. The serial controlled motor driver abbreviated scmd for the rest of this guide is a dc motor driver thats been designed to drive small dc motors with ease. Two input signals in1 and in2 can be used to contro. A stepper relies on the short throw of each winding to guarantee it reaches the desired point in time. Two input signals in1 and in2 can be used to c view tb6612fng on sparkfun.
As my father was a bit into model cars and stuff, he has some escs and brushless motors lying around that i can use. The advantage is reduced space and less pin needed from microcontroller. Dc gearmotors or brushless dc motors are more likely. Brushless dc motor control adafruit motor selection guide. Two input signals in1 and in2 can be used to control the motor in one of four function modes cw, ccw, shortbrake, and stop.
Dc 12v 24v 36v 15a 500w brushless motor controller hall bldc driver board brushless motor controllerblue 5. The only difference is if you were to take a brushless motor and unfold it into a straight line youd have a linear motor. Sparkfun motor driver dual tb6612fng 1a rob14451 rohs description the tb6612fng motor driver can control up to two dc motors at a constant current of 1. And the locations of the magnets and windings are reversed. Oct 08, 2014 brushless motors are ubiquitous in rc applications and robotics, but are usually driven with lowcost motor controllers that have to be controlled with rcstyle pwm signals and dont allow for. The two motor outputs a and b can be separately controlled, the speed of each motor. Boasting the same 4245 psoc and 2channel motor ports as the scmd, the sparkfun qwiic motor driver. Pricing and availability on millions of electronic components from digikey electronics.
With an operating voltage range from 0 v to 11 v and builtin protection against reversevoltage, undervoltage, overcurrent, and overtemperature, this driver is a great solution for powering a small, lowvoltage motor. Brushless dc motor driver bldc8015a philippines makerlab. Now that you know how to control a dc motor with the l298n motor driver, lets build a simple example to control the speed and direction of one dc motor. Jan 20, 2017 look no further than the sparkfun haptic motor driver. Sparkfun sparkfun motor driver dual tb6612fng 1a arduino library the tb6612fng motor driver can control up to two dc motors at a constant current of 1. Two input signals in1 and in2 can be used to contro sparkfun motor driver dual tb6612fng 1a rob09457 sparkfun electronics. The motor works just fine from about 34% up to 100% using the ardumoto shield.
1184 299 1038 947 1137 1303 1046 1223 1545 385 1211 1615 872 239 1604 136 274 1294 856 502 1395 1115 489 306 1417 326 147 773 466 1038